将图片转换成HTML格式是一种常见的网页设计需求,尤其是在创建网页内容时,我们经常需要将一些图形元素嵌入到HTML中,这个过程并不复杂,只需要一些基本的HTML和CSS知识就可以实现,下面,我将详细解释如何将图片转换成HTML,并提供一些实用的技巧和注意事项。
我们需要了解HTML中的<img>
标签,它是用于在网页上显示图像的基本标签,这个标签的语法非常简单,只需要指定图片的源文件(src属性)和可选的替代文本(alt属性),就可以在网页上显示图片了。
如果你想在网页上显示一张名为“example.jpg”的图片,你可以使用以下HTML代码:
<img src="example.jpg" alt="示例图片">
这里的src
属性指定了图片的路径,而alt
属性则提供了图片的替代文本,这对于提高网站的可访问性非常重要,尤其是在图片无法显示时,屏幕阅读器可以读取这个文本。
我们还需要考虑图片的布局和样式,CSS在这里扮演了重要的角色,通过CSS,我们可以控制图片的大小、位置、边框等样式,如果你想让图片居中显示,并且设置一个边框,你可以使用以下CSS代码:
img { display: block; margin-left: auto; margin-right: auto; border: 1px solid #000; }
将这段CSS代码添加到你的样式表中,就可以实现图片的居中和边框效果。
如果你想让图片响应式地适应不同的屏幕尺寸,可以使用CSS的媒体查询来设置不同的样式规则。
@media (max-width: 600px) { img { width: 100%; height: auto; } }
这段代码意味着在屏幕宽度小于或等于600像素时,图片的宽度将自动调整为100%,而高度则保持图片的原始比例。
在实际应用中,我们还需要考虑图片的加载速度和性能,为了提高网页的加载速度,我们可以使用现代的图片格式,如WebP,它比传统的JPEG或PNG格式提供了更好的压缩率和图像质量,我们还可以利用HTML的loading
属性来控制图片的加载行为,
<img src="example.webp" alt="示例图片" loading="lazy">
这里的loading="lazy"
属性告诉浏览器在页面滚动到图片位置之前不要加载图片,这样可以减少初始页面加载的数据量,提高页面的加载速度。
我们还需要注意版权问题,在使用图片时,确保你有权使用这些图片,或者它们是公共领域的,如果图片是受版权保护的,未经授权使用可能会引发法律问题。
通过上述步骤,你可以轻松地将图片转换成HTML,并在网页上以美观和响应式的方式展示它们,这不仅能够提升网页的视觉效果,还能提高用户的浏览体验。
还没有评论,来说两句吧...